On New Brunswick's Waterways Paddlers visiting New Brunswick have many options across the province to practice their craft. Rivers, lakes and coastline all provide kayakers, rafters, sailors and canoeists with excellent choices for a memorable journey. |

| Get outside! A well-developed network of New Brunswick Provincial Parks and Sentier New Brunswick Trail stretches along the Saint John River Valley, offering camping, hiking, fishing, power boating, sailing, windsurfing and golfing activities throughout the watershed.
